Big news: Tom Felton auto, no filmcards (unless they were left off the press release) Crystal card case toppers 15 autos: Daniel Radcliffe/Katie Leung Double Tom Felton as Draco Malfoy Helena Bonham Carter as Bellatrix Lestrange Natalia Tena as Nymphadora Tonks Death Eater Puzzle Autograph Cards (Tav MacDougall, Richard Cubison, Richard Trinder) Timothy Bateson as Kreacher Robert Hardy as Cornelius Fudge David Thewlis as Remus Lupin Brendan Gleeson as Mad-Eye Moody Sian Thomas as Amelia Bones Kathryn Hunter as Arabella Figg Jason Piper as Bane Harry Melling as Dudley Dursley 15 costumes: Harry Potter’s blue hooded shirt Harry’s school sweater Hermoine Granger’s white sweater Ron Weasley’s Tie Ron’s school pants Luna’s school sweater Luna’s purple pants Cho Chang’s striped sweater Ginny’s green jacket Ginny’s school pants Lucius Malfoy costume fabric George Weasley’s beige shirt Voldemort and Dumbledore Double Fred and George’s white/floral shirt Double Griffindor and Slytherin Costume Fabric Double 12 props: Cauldron and stand Flying Memos Daily Prophet 1 Daily Prophet 2 Dark Arts Book Pages Umbridge Notebook Paper Ravenclaw Robe and OWLs Double Death Eater Mask and Costume Double 1 Death Eater Mask and Costume Double 2 Death Eater Mask and Costume Double 3 Curtains and Doily from Umbridge’s Office Double Test Tube and Stand Double (http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v451/kbmum/OOTP/HP5_Updt_Mock20Album02.jpg) (http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v451/kbmum/OOTP/HP5_Updt_mock_box-1.jpg) : Re: OOTP Update Cards : HPfamily December 04, 2007, 08:21:29 AM Holy Cow!!! The odds for OOTPU should be:
Costume card 1:24 packs (1 per box or 10 per case) Auto 1:48 packs (5 per case) Prop card 1:80 packs (3 per case) FilmCards 1:80 (3 per case) Foil chase cards 1:4.8 packs (5 per box) 1 box topper per box 1 case topper per case Unless there are dud boxes (no inserts in a box), nine boxes per case will have two premium inserts and one box will have three.
